黑狐家游戏

网站响应时间过长是什么意思,深度解析,网站响应时间过长背后的原因及解决方案

欧气 1 0

本文目录导读:

  1. 网站响应时间过长的含义
  2. 网站响应时间过长的原因
  3. 减少网站响应时间过长的解决方案

网站响应时间过长的含义

网站响应时间过长,指的是用户在访问网站时,从发起请求到得到响应所需要的时间过长,这通常表现为页面加载缓慢、操作卡顿、页面无法正常显示等问题,对于网站运营者来说,响应时间过长不仅影响用户体验,还可能影响网站在搜索引擎中的排名。

网站响应时间过长的原因

1、服务器性能不足

网站响应时间过长是什么意思,深度解析,网站响应时间过长背后的原因及解决方案

图片来源于网络,如有侵权联系删除

服务器是网站运行的载体,如果服务器性能不足,如CPU、内存、硬盘等硬件配置过低,将导致网站响应时间过长。

2、网站代码优化不足

网站代码的优化程度直接影响到网站的响应速度,如果网站代码存在大量冗余、未优化的SQL语句、过多的JavaScript和CSS等,都会导致响应时间过长。

3、数据库查询效率低

数据库是网站数据存储的基础,如果数据库查询效率低,如索引不合理、查询语句不规范等,将导致响应时间过长。

4、网络延迟

网络延迟是导致网站响应时间过长的另一个重要原因,这可能与用户所在地区的网络环境、服务器所在地区等因素有关。

5、外部资源加载过多

网站中加载的外部资源(如图片、视频、广告等)过多,会导致页面加载时间延长,从而影响网站响应速度。

6、缓存策略不当

缓存策略不当会导致用户每次访问网站时都需要重新加载资源,从而影响响应速度。

减少网站响应时间过长的解决方案

1、优化服务器性能

网站响应时间过长是什么意思,深度解析,网站响应时间过长背后的原因及解决方案

图片来源于网络,如有侵权联系删除

提高服务器硬件配置,如增加CPU核心数、内存容量、硬盘读写速度等,以提升服务器性能。

2、优化网站代码

对网站代码进行优化,包括:

(1)精简代码,删除冗余代码和注释;

(2)优化SQL语句,合理使用索引;

(3)减少JavaScript和CSS的使用,使用压缩后的文件;

(4)合并CSS和JavaScript文件,减少HTTP请求次数。

3、优化数据库查询

(1)优化数据库索引,提高查询效率;

(2)规范SQL语句,避免使用复杂的查询语句;

(3)分页查询,避免一次性加载过多数据。

4、优化网络环境

网站响应时间过长是什么意思,深度解析,网站响应时间过长背后的原因及解决方案

图片来源于网络,如有侵权联系删除

(1)选择优质的云服务器,降低网络延迟;

(2)优化DNS解析,提高域名解析速度;

(3)使用CDN加速,将静态资源分发到全球节点,降低用户访问延迟。

5、优化外部资源加载

(1)精简外部资源,如压缩图片、视频等;

(2)使用懒加载技术,按需加载外部资源;

(3)优化广告加载,减少广告对网站响应速度的影响。

6、优化缓存策略

(1)合理设置缓存时间,避免频繁刷新资源;

(2)使用浏览器缓存和服务器缓存,提高资源加载速度。

网站响应时间过长是网站运营过程中常见的问题,需要我们从多个方面进行优化,通过优化服务器性能、代码、数据库查询、网络环境、外部资源加载和缓存策略,可以有效提高网站响应速度,提升用户体验。

标签: #网站响应时间过长怎么办

黑狐家游戏
  • 评论列表

留言评论